Discover a charming piece of history with this exquisite Mexborough Prattware Wesleyan Chapel Money Box from 1848. This delightful item is intricately modelled in the shape of a chapel, featuring putti on the front corners and standing on elegant ball feet.
The front of the money box is inscribed with the name "Emma Sutton Bampton" and the date "June 18 1848", adding a personal touch and a glimpse into its past. Measuring H17cm and L15cm, this unique piece is sure to be a standout addition to any collection.
